RoseClear Ultra Gun! kills greenfly, blackfly and other aphids, even those that are hiding away under leaves. It controls existing infections of the key diseases on roses and other ornamentals, namely rose blackspot, powdery mildew and rust. It protects plants from further infestations of aphids and diseases with a recommended spraying interval of 3 - 4 weeks between applications.

A quick convenient spray, as soon as you see the first few greenfly or blackfly will kill them within 24 hours and help prevent them multiplying into a huge population that could otherwise weaken your plants and disfigure the growth of stems, leaves and buds. The systemic spray will be absorbed through the leaves and move around the plant to give the treated plants, including any new growth internal protection from pests and diseases.

If rose blackspot was a problem last year you should collect up and dispose of any leaves that show the tell-tale signs of disease and start spraying your roses early in spring when the new leaves first start to unfurl. This will provide a clean start to the season that can be maintained with more regular treatments (do not compost infected leaves as the spores will survive and may re-infect your prize plants).
